Royal Hairs Boss, Steve Maduka Marries Lover Sandra Iheuwa

Posted on August 20, 2021

Serial entrepreneur and CEO, Royal Hairs Limited, Steve Maduka shut down the city of Lagos last Sunday as he walked down the aisle with his sweetheart Sandra Iheuwa.

The wedding which held Sunday 15 August at the exquisite Monarch Event Centre, Lagos, Nigeria, was the talk of the town as it was attended by top dignitaries from both the government and business world.

Actor and Comedian Okey Bakassi handled the mic as the Master of Ceremony while DJ Neptune and musician Timi Dakolo kept the floor on fire.

The couple had performed their traditional marriage rites on Saturday, 7 August at the bride’s home town in Mbaise Local Government Area of Imo State.

Sandra, a United States-based entrepreneur and the hair mogul were said to have courted for several years.

They managed to keep the relationship very quiet to avoid the prying eyes of paparazzis until when Steve announced the union by sharing several colorful clips from their traditional wedding.

After their traditional wedding in Imo where they are both, they had the court wedding on Thursday 12 August at the Ikoyi registry and capped the celebration with the white wedding and reception last Sunday.
